Did you know? If you are a member of the TELUS World of Science Edmonton, your membership offers free admission to a consortium of other science centres and museums around North America! It’s part of the Association of Science and Technology Centres Travel Passport Program. The closest option for Edmontonians is Calgary’s TELUS Spark Science Centre!

DIGITAL IMMERSION GALLERY
  • Referred to as the “3,000 square foot pixel playground”, the Digital Immersion Gallery is a unique chance to be a part of a story or visual experience. Imagery covers the gallery from floor to ceiling and often involves motion detection features!
  • “Sacred Defenders of the Universe” is the current feature in the Digital Immersion Gallery. It tells the story of how four heroes emerged from “The Great Conflict” to defend the earth. My daughter was absolutely captivated! We returned to the gallery three times during our visit and watched the full story several times!
  • Tip: “Sacred Defenders of the Universe” is on until November 2023

OPEN STUDIO
  • Its slogan is “Think with your hands”! Open studio is a place to play, create and tinker! This area features everything from electronics to old fashioned building materials and everything in between. A popular area features virtual reality games. We also tried making a stop-motion movie, constructing air-pressure ball tunnels, and the girls’ favourite, the dress form centre!
  • Tip: If you’re hoping to try one of the Virtual Reality experiences, make that your first stop of the day, as it tends to get filled up fast on busy days!

CREATIVE KIDS MUSEUM
  • Billed at 10,000 square feet of fun for young scientists, the Creative Kids Museum offers much more than just the maze-like play structure pictured here! There is a lot of hands-on play for kids, with options to please all the senses! The Theatre allows kids to dress up and perform on stage – or work behind the scenes and operate the lights and background effects! A huge water play area takes up the centre of this gallery – you might consider packing a change of clothes!
  • Tip: The Creative Kids Museum has bathroom buildings and water fountains right inside. There are separate areas for babies and toddlers. There’s also a nursing room available.

THE BRAINASIUM
  • The Brainasium is much more than just a tall tower and super slide! This outdoor play space is full of opportunities to think AND play! We LOVE the extensive log climbing area, the undulating balance beam, the different kinds of swings and so much more. There are also signs located all around the park with information and tips about things like risky play and information on why play is important! Something we’re looking forward to for our summer visit is the new Junkyard Playground – a unique area for playing with discarded materials.
  • Tip: The Brainasium is a fenced play area and is only accessible from inside TELUS Spark.

Know Before You Go
  • TELUS World of Science Edmonton members can access TELUS Spark for FREE!
  • Parking at Spark is $7 and can be paid at machines located near the entrance. Coins and credit cards are accepted.
  • Loonie lockers are located just inside the Spark main entrance
  • Infinity Dome shows are included with your admission! If the science center is busy, line up 15-20 minutes early so that you don’t miss out.
  • The Spark Eatery and Astronaut Ice Cream cafe are two options when visiting Spark. You can also bring your own food and use tables provided in the eatery or outside in the Brainasium.
